The eastern equine encephalitis virus (EEEV) is a rare but severe mosquito-borne virus that attacks the central nervous system, causing serious health consequences.
Infected humans and horses are considered dead-end hosts for EEEV, which means they cannot transmit the virus back to mosquitoes, unlike infected birds.
